Roque Nublo is a volcanic rock on the island of Gran Canaria, Canary Islands, Spain. It is 67 m tall, and its top is 1,813 m above sea level. The Roque Nublo is the third altitude of the island of Gran Canaria.
It is considered one of the biggest natural crags in the world.

Travel Information
Roque Nublo is located in the central municipality of Tejeda, which is about 1-hour drive from Las Palmas.
There is a small free parking lot on-site and followed by a short 40 minutes hike to get to the top. The hike is not very difficult but the temperatures can be quite high, especially in summer, so make sure you bring plenty of water.
The parking lot does not have many spots so I would advise again to get there early to ensure your spot.
Getting there by public transportation can be quite a long way and very difficult so I would definitely suggest renting a car to give yourself the comfort of managing your own times,
